原文:#include

vector vector 可以理解成動態數組,動態占用空間,動態釋放空間。 聲明方式 vector 支持任意訪問,跟數組一樣直接調用下標。但是不支持任意插入,只支持在末端插入。 vector 動態占用空間和釋放空間都是二的若干次方的占用和釋放,也就是若實際占用等於最大占用,最大占用空間將翻一倍。如果實際占用空間低於最大占用空間的 dfrac ,那么最大占用空間就會變成原來的一半。所以 vecto ...

2018-11-01 16:34 0 1694 推薦指數:

查看詳情

#include <vector>

雙端隊列deque比向量vector更有優勢 vector是動態數組,在堆上 vector比array更常用 不需要變長,容量較小,用array 需要變長,容量較大,用vector 1 at() 取出下標 2 c_str() 執行 3 clear() 清空 ...

Sat Jun 25 05:50:00 CST 2016 0 5728
#include<vector> 的用法

C++ vector 用法(#include <vector>) 標准庫Vector類型 使用需要的頭文件: #include <vector> VectorVector 是一個類模板。不是一種數據類型。 Vector<int>是一種 ...

Thu Dec 02 11:40:00 CST 2021 0 857
C++ vector 用法(#include <vector>)

vector是一種順序容器,事實上和數組差不多,但它比數組更優越。一般來說數組不能動態拓展,因此在程序運行的時候不是浪費內存,就是造成越界。而vector正好彌補了這個缺陷,它的特征是相當於可分配拓展的數組,它的隨機訪問快,在中間插入和刪除慢,但在末端插入和刪除快,而且如果你用.at()訪問的話 ...

Sat Mar 10 21:16:00 CST 2012 1 29076
C++ STL之 #include <vector>頭文件

vector是C++標准庫容器,其詳細用途可參見如下網址: http://www.cplusplus.com/reference/vector/vector/ ...

Tue Jun 02 23:04:00 CST 2020 0 2118
vector基本

vector初始化 string和vertor下標只能訪問已經存在的元素,不能創建元素(編譯不會出錯,運行時出錯) 下標越界編譯運行都沒有報錯,但是已經出錯 向空的vector中添加元素 統計 ...

Wed Nov 30 04:01:00 CST 2016 0 2464
Vector

vector,向量,從一個點,往一個方向無限延申。anki公司最初給他們的第一個家庭機器人取名就復用了vector這個眾所周知的名字。 要談vector,我還是先從vector的小兄弟cozmo談起...... 其實他們最初是個玩具公司,他們開發的賽車玩具我也沒玩過,直到可愛的cozmo出現 ...

Sat Mar 14 21:55:00 CST 2020 0 1077
#include< > 和 #include” ” 的區別

一、#include< >   #include< > 引用的是編譯器的類庫路徑里面的頭文件。   假如你編譯器定義的自帶頭文件引用在 C:\Keil\c51\INC\ 下面,則 #include<stdio.h> 引用的就是 C:\Keil\c51\INC ...

Sat Apr 02 05:55:00 CST 2016 1 35614
include>和<%@ include%>的區別

個人筆記(並非自己總結,而是從別人的博客上看到的) <jsp:include> :動態包含 1、<jsp:include>包含的是html文件 舉例: DynamicInclude.jsp: <%@pagecontentType="text/html ...

Mon Jun 26 05:59:00 CST 2017 0 12005
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M